@tomjs/create-app
Version:
Create a node/web/electron/vscode project based on tomjs
53 lines (52 loc) • 979 B
JSON
{
"publisher": "tomjs",
"name": "ext-simple",
"displayName": "简单插件",
"type": "commonjs",
"version": "0.0.0",
"description": "简单插件",
"keywords": [
"HBuilderX"
],
"categories": [
"Other"
],
"main": "./dist/index.js",
"engines": {
"node": ">=16.17.0",
"HBuilderX": "^2.7.0"
},
"activationEvents": [],
"contributes": {
"commands": [
{
"command": "tomjs.xxx.showHello",
"title": "Hello World"
}
],
"menus": {
"editor/context": [
{
"command": "tomjs.xxx.showHello",
"group": "z_commands",
"when": "editorTextFocus"
},
{
"group": "z_commands"
}
]
}
},
"scripts": {
"dev": "tsdown --watch",
"build": "tsdown",
"lint": "eslint --fix"
},
"dependencies": {
"@tomjs/hbuilderx": "^1.2.0"
},
"devDependencies": {
"@types/node": "^20.19.27",
"tsdown": "^0.18.4"
}
}